.dev-Domains werden nicht aufgelöst

666
Luke Taylor

Mir ist heute aufgefallen, dass .devbeim Versuch, auf web.dev zuzugreifen, in meinem MacBook keine Domains aufgelöst werden . Sie alle sagen "__.dev weigerte sich, eine Verbindung herzustellen." Ich habe eine schnelle Google-Suche durchgeführt site:.dev, und alle aufgelisteten Domains verursachen denselben Fehler, obwohl ich sie alle von meinem Telefon im selben Netzwerk laden kann. Ich verwende 1.1.1.1meinen DNS-Server, hatte aber selbst nach einem DNS-Serverwechsel dasselbe Problem. Ich schaute hinein /etc/hostsund fand nichts relevantes. Was könnte das Problem sein?

0
Ich habe .local für ähnliche Arbeiten in der Vergangenheit verwendet. Der Link unten zeigt an, dass die .dev-TLD vor kurzem veraltet wurde. https://medium.engineering/use-a-dev-domain-not-anymore-95219778e6fd Christopher Hostage vor 5 Jahren 0
Ich versuche nicht, es für die Entwicklung zu fälschen, ich versuche, eine Verbindung zu einer echten Domäne im Internet herzustellen. Das "dev" -Verhalten, das veraltet wurde, war die Umleitung zu localhost, die von vielen Entwicklern verwendet wurde. Ich glaube nicht, dass ich jemals so etwas auf meiner Maschine konfiguriert habe, obwohl es möglich ist. Luke Taylor vor 5 Jahren 0

1 Antwort auf die Frage

1
hellork

Versuchen Sie es mit https://statt http://in der Adressleiste. Überprüfen Sie die Firewall und versuchen Sie es mit einem anderen Browser. Deaktivieren Sie die Kindersicherung und -erweiterungen des Browsers. Das Öffnen eines "Inkognito-Fensters" oder einer sicheren Browsersitzung kann manchmal ausreichen.

Wenn nichts anderes klappt, können Sie zu einem Terminal gehen und tippen dig web.dev? Der Befehl dig fragt den DNS-Server nach detaillierten Adressinformationen. Versuchen Sie, direkt zu der aufgelisteten IP-Adresse zu gehen ANSWER SECTION, in diesem Fall https://216.239.34.21 .

web.dev. 162 IN A 216.239.34.21 
Inkognito und `https` beheben das Problem nicht. `dig` löst die richtige IP auf. Wenn Sie direkt dorthin navigieren, erhalten Sie eine 404, da Google den Webserver für die Website eingerichtet hat Luke Taylor vor 5 Jahren 0
Das ist interessant. Können Sie "-c 1 web.dev" ping und die richtige Adresse erhalten? Wenn ja, werden wahrscheinlich die Betriebssystem-Resolver und Firewalls ausgeschlossen. Verwenden Sie Chrome oder Safari? DesktopServer kann auch falsch konfiguriert und ausgeführt werden. Informationen zum Ändern der .dev-TLD https://docs.serverpress.com/article/232-how-to-change-top-level-domain-dev-extension-google-chrome-users finden Sie hier hellork vor 5 Jahren 0
"ping -c 1 web.dev" zeigt die Auflösung in "localhost" ("PING web.dev (127.0.0.1): 56 Datenbytes"). Luke Taylor vor 5 Jahren 0
Ich habe noch nie ein Programm namens DesktopServer verwendet Luke Taylor vor 5 Jahren 0